2. What Documents Are Needed for Customs Clearance from Shenzhen to UK?
Proper documentation is essential for fast and compliant clearance. Below is a helpful checklist:
| Document |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Commercial Invoice | Declares value, quantity, and product details |
| Packing List | Provides package dimensions and weight per item |
| Bill of Lading / AWB | Transport document from carrier or forwarder |
| Importer EORI Number | Required by HMRC for customs declarations |
| UK VAT Number (if applicable) | For reclaiming VAT on eligible imports |
| Certificate of Origin | For determining tariff preference or duty relief |
| HS Code Classification | For assigning correct import duties and taxes |
Moreover, regulated products (e.g., electronics, food, chemicals) may need extra licenses or compliance documents like CE certificates or SDS sheets.
3. How Long Does Customs Clearance from China to UK Take?
The clearance timeline can vary based on method, accuracy of paperwork, and customs workload. Here’s a general breakdown:
| Shipping Method | Transit Time (China to UK) | Customs Clearance Time |
|---|---|---|
| Air Freight | 4–7 days | 1–3 business days |
| Sea Freight (FCL) | 25–35 days | 2–4 business days |
| Sea Freight (LCL) | 28–38 days | 3–5 business days |
| Express Courier | 3–5 days | Handled by courier (1 day) |
Therefore, timely and accurate document submission significantly shortens overall shipping time.
4. How Are Duties and Taxes Calculated in the UK?
Import taxes in the UK generally include:
- Import Duty: Based on HS Code and customs value (CIF)
- VAT: Usually 20% on total value including duty and shipping
- Excise Duties: Applicable to specific goods like alcohol or tobacco
Example Calculation:
| Item | Value (GBP) |
|---|---|
| Product Value | £1,000 |
| Freight Cost | £200 |
| Insurance (optional) | £20 |
| CIF Value | £1,220 |
| Import Duty (5%) | £61 |
| Subtotal | £1,281 |
| VAT (20%) | £256.20 |
| Total Import Cost | £1,537.20 |
Customs brokers use the CIF method (Cost + Insurance + Freight) to determine the dutiable amount.
5. What Are Common Challenges with UK Customs Clearance?
Even seasoned importers face complications if proper care isn’t taken. Common issues include:
- Incorrect HS codes
- Missing or incomplete commercial invoices
- Undeclared restricted goods
- Delayed submission of entry documents
- Discrepancy between declared and actual value
Moreover, since Brexit, importers must deal with additional declarations for goods from third countries—even if routed through the EU.

8. How Do Shipping Methods Affect UK Customs Clearance?
Different transportation options come with varying customs handling processes.
| Shipping Mode | Customs Approach | Best Use Case |
|---|---|---|
| Air Freight | Fast but requires precise documentation | Urgent cargo or high-value goods |
| Sea Freight (LCL) | Shared container, risk of inspection delay | Cost-sensitive small shipments |
| Sea Freight (FCL) | Easier control, lower inspection risk | Bulk cargo or single-consignee loads |
| Express Courier | Clearance handled by courier (DHL, FedEx) | Samples, eCommerce parcels |
Understanding the pros and cons of each can help optimize your supply chain and reduce clearance bottlenecks.

FAQ
1. What is an EORI number and why is it needed?
An EORI (Economic Operator Registration and Identification) number is mandatory for any UK business importing goods from overseas.
2. Can I reclaim VAT on imports into the UK?
Yes, if you’re VAT-registered in the UK, you can reclaim import VAT through your VAT return using your C79 certificate.
3. Do I need a license to import from China to UK?
Not for general goods, but restricted items like chemicals, electronics, or food may require special permits or certifications.
4. What happens if my goods are held at customs?
Customs will notify your broker. You may need to provide additional documents or pay any pending duties before release.
5. What is DDP shipping and how does it help?
Delivered Duty Paid (DDP) means the seller pays all duties/taxes. It simplifies clearance for the buyer, especially in the UK.
